Caption

An Act to Promote the Community School Program

Impact

The bill proposes an additional one-time allocation of $2,000,000 in both fiscal years 2023-24 and 2024-25, intended for grants that would support public elementary and secondary schools in implementing the community school model. This financial backing is expected to empower schools to better serve their communities and adapt educational offerings to match local demands. It could also enhance partnerships with families and local organizations, which is a cornerstone of the community school concept.

Summary

LD1527, also known as an Act to Promote the Community School Program, aims to enhance the support and infrastructure for community schools in Maine. The bill mandates the Department of Education to develop an application process and specific criteria for the designation of community schools, which are intended to provide comprehensive education services focused on meeting local needs. This is seen as a significant step toward promoting educational equity and accessibility throughout the state.
